2. Leverage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) for Precision
The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) is an indispensable tool in finding car parts precisely tailored to your vehicle. This unique 17-character code encodes vital information about the vehicle's manufacturer, model, engine type, and production details. When shopping online or consulting mechanics, always provide the VIN to:
- Ensure compatibility and avoid incorrect parts
- Access detailed part histories and recalls
- Streamline the ordering process for specific parts
3. Consult Vehicle Repair Manuals and OEM Data
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) manuals and online databases are treasure troves of technical information. They help you identify the exact specifications of parts, including part numbers, standards, and assembly diagrams. This info simplifies finding car parts that flawlessly match your vehicle, minimizing the risk of errors and returns.

3. Salvage Yards and Auto Recyclers
For budget-conscious vehicle repairs, salvage yards offer used, tested parts at significantly lower prices. These are ideal for:
- Old or rare vehicle parts that are hard to find
- Restoration projects requiring authentic vintage parts
- Environmental sustainability by reusing components
4. Manufacturer and Dealer Websites
Official manufacturer sites and authorized dealerships guarantee genuine parts with warranty coverage. This is especially critical for high-performance or safety-critical components like brakes and airbags.
